Python 幾個常用的內建函數

#build-in functions
'''
1 list(iter) 將iter轉換爲list
2 tuple(iter) 將iter轉換爲tuple
3 enumerate(iter,start=0) 
4 len(seq) 獲取seq的長度
5 max(iter,key=None) or max(arg0,arg1,arg2..,key = None) 
6 min(iter,key=None) or min(arg0,arg1,arg2..,key=None)
7 reversed(seq)
8 sorted(iter,cmp=None,key=None,reverse=False) #排序
9 sum(seq[,start]), start is init value
10 zip(iter1,iter2,...) zip(*zip(iter1,iter2,...))
11 cmp(x,y)->integer
12 locals()
13 globals()
14 map(function,iter1,iter2,...)
15 reduce(function,iter1,init)
16 filter(function,iter)
17 next(iter)
'''

具體就不解釋說明了,直接上代碼,查看輸出結果更爲直觀

詳細例子:

class Point:
    def __init__(self,x,y):
        self.x = x
        self.y = y
    def dist(self,b):
        dis = (self.x - b.x)*(self.x - b.x) + (self.y - b.y)*(self.y - b.y)
        return math.sqrt(dis)
    def __repr__(self):
        return "(%d,%d)" % (self.x,self.y)

def func(a,b):
    if a.x == b.x:
        return a.y - b.y
    return a.x - b.x

list = []

for i in xrange(0,10):
    x = random.randint(0,20)
    y = random.randint(0,20)
    p = Point(x,y)
    list.append(p)

list.sort(cmp=func)

a = [1,2,3,4,5]
b = [5,4,3,2,1]
print sum(a,1)
c = zip(a,b)
print c
print zip(*c)
print cmp(a,b)
loc = locals()['math']
print loc.sqrt(5)

print map(lambda x,y: x*y,a,b)
print reduce(lambda x,y: x+y,a,-1)
print filter(lambda x: x>3,a)
結果:

sum:  16
zip:  [(1, 5), (2, 4), (3, 3), (4, 2), (5, 1)]
zip*:  [(1, 2, 3, 4, 5), (5, 4, 3, 2, 1)]
cmp:  -1
locals:  2.2360679775
map:  [5, 8, 9, 8, 5]
reduce:  14
filter:  [4, 5]
